Suicide Prevention Awareness Week takes place from 4th-10th September this year.

“Read between the lines” is the message that Choose Life is sending out to people throughout the Borders during the week, to promote the involvement of whole communities in suicide prevention.

The focus of this year’s campaign is to support the general public to look out for signs of suicidal intent in the people around them – friends, colleagues, family members or neighbours and encourage them to talk about how they feel.
